Output 19e8b8131baafc10bde4ea5f619501b37cd25a80ce48fdc1e7171aa9a360d25e:5

value
58385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15a25876f5a0dfdb5702b191d03bf1c07dc2befb OP_EQUAL
address
33fQbYGBWetzuggpW7Wpsfzp1p5n2miuzG
transaction
19e8b8131baafc10bde4ea5f619501b37cd25a80ce48fdc1e7171aa9a360d25e
confirmations
235012
spent
true